Hi all, I thought I would check the impeller today. I have a load of spare impellers (came with the boat) and it was just a bit of light relief really - I had fitted the other storm window, put a bit of sealant along the hull to deck joint, fitted the replacement prop boss plug, fitted the nylon rollers on the new anchor roller and I just thought it would be wise to see how easy it is to do. Well... joy of joys it is easy to get at and the little bronze cover is attached with knurled knobs... just twisted them and off they came.. all went well and I levered out the old impeller with a couple of screwdrivers and I was quite pleased with myself. One thing did surprise me - the instructions said to undo the little screw but it just came all the way out with screw in situ. Not to worry, I put a cable tie around the new impeller and tried to slot it in - no joy! I thought I was not aligned with the slot (mine has a slot - not a hole for the screw)but no matter what I tried it would not go in! Anyway I took it out and compared it to the old one - they were not the same - the internal diameter on the old one is about 12mm and the new one is less - maybe 10mm. Whatever next - I checked the part number and the new one was correct for an MD6! I can only assume that someone has changed the water pump at some stage and all my spare impellers (4 of them) are no use to me! I just put the old one back in and I have ordered the correct size replacements. Lesson learnt - check everything!!!
